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,368,404,563
Lastest Block:
2,041,933
Utxos:
1,982,935
Nodes:
315
OmniXEP Contracts:
281
Block details
[STAKE]
15/01/2026 01:05:36 UTC
Txid
43b103cb943767386a687c33974fa8aced03d399cee87c8a2e4879065d27835a
Block
1,992,743
Block hash
25519656651ccb3a38fdaecc10137a64931214a3bdf6589de84ade74b213cf4c
Stake amount
199.91576868 XEP
Sender
ep1qykkpt9yfymt04jgdj43k0erptlemv45wskyj9f
Recipient
ep1qykkpt9yfymt04jgdj43k0erptlemv45wskyj9f
(2,521,917.62260918 XEP)